This drawbridge spans Boca Raton's South Inlet, carrying Ocean Boulevard (A1A) across it. This bridge presently opens on demand, not on a schedule. It was originally named the Boca Raton Inlet Bridge, but renamed for Haven Ashe, a bridge-tender of this bridge from 1942 to 1964, when it was replaced by the present concrete structure. The original wooden bridge opened electrically, but had to be closed manually by Ashe.
